In Kenya's fast-growing electronics industry, protecting printed circuit boards (PCBs) from harsh environmental conditions—like dust, humidity, and temperature fluctuations—is critical. That's where conformal coating comes in: a thin, protective layer applied to PCBs to shield components from corrosion, short circuits, and mechanical damage. Whether you're manufacturing consumer gadgets, industrial machinery, or medical devices, choosing the right conformal coating supplier can make all the difference in product durability and performance.
